Salford interested in Brian Noble

Correspondent

Salford owner Marwan Koukash has revealed he wants to hold talks with former Great Britain coach Brian Noble.

Noble has said in the past he is keen for a return to management in the Super League should a vacancy become available.

Consequently Koukash feels it would only be right for a meeting to take place between the two to discuss matters at the Reds.

Koukash told the M.E.N: “I am interested to see what he has to say about Salford. appointing a new coach is a very important decision – we have to get it right.

“We have to take out time and do things properly. Brian Noble has talked in the past about the potential of the Salford club and the need for a successful team in Manchester. I look forward to speaking with him – we will appoint the best man for the job. I feel I need to bring in someone who shares my vision.”

The Reds shortlist is reported to include Noble, Tim Sheens and Tony Iro the assistant coach of the  New Zealand Warriors.
